3.8.5. LED_WWAN# Signal

The LED_WWAN# signal of BG96 Mini PCIe is used to indicate the network status of the module, and
can absorb the current up to 40mA. According to the following circuit, in order to reduce the current of the
LED, a resistor must be placed in series with the LED. The LED is emitting light when the LED_WWAN#
output signal is active low.
Figure 10: LED_WWAN# Signal Reference Circuit Diagram
There are two indication modes for LED_WWAN# signal to indicate network status, which can be
switched through following AT commands:
AT+QCFG="ledmode",0 (Default setting)
AT+QCFG="ledmode",1
The following tables show the detailed network status indications of the LED_WWAN# signal.
